What is Turabian style?
Turabian is a simplified version of Chicago style designed specifically for students. It's named after Kate L. Turabian and is widely used in history, humanities, and some social sciences. The current edition is the 9th (2018).
What's the difference between Notes-Bibliography and Author-Date?
Notes-Bibliography uses footnotes or endnotes with a bibliography (common in history and humanities). Author-Date uses parenthetical in-text citations like (Smith 2023, 45) with a reference list (common in social sciences).
